World Starport (Sp)[edit]

Ewaos has a Class C Starport, an average quality installation which features amenities including unrefined fuel for starships, some brokerage services for passengers and cargo, and a variety of ship provisions. There is a shipyard capable of doing maintenance and other kinds of repair. Ports of this classification generally have only a downport, unless this is a trade port or system with an hostile environment mainworld.

World Population (P)[edit]

Ewaos has a population of 40 sophonts (tens).

  • This is a Low Population World and the population would be too low to sustain itself without significant outside assistance. This may represent a transient population such as the crew of a starship, the final survivors of a dying colony, an advance team setting up to receive colonists, or a small outpost where establishing a colony is not the primary objective.
  • The population consists of Aslan.

World Languages[edit]

  • Trokh: The universal language of the modern Aslan monoculture.
    • Aslan Languages: Note that some Aslan clans retain obscure or archaic languages for personal use in addition to Trokh.
